The Railway Inn

A pub serving food in Greenfield.

The Railway came to Greenfield, the station was built. Someone had the foresight to build a house for overnight stops, a licence to sell alcohol was applied for and over 150 years later this gem of a water hole is still very much in use.

Drink % Brewery
Acorn Barnsley Bitter 3.8 Acorn Brewery of Barnsley

Brewed using the finest quality Maris Otter malt and English hops. Chestnut in colour, having a well rounded, rich flavour, it retains a lasting bitter finish. Brewed using yeast strains used in the 1850’s to brew ‘Barnsley Bitter’.

Tasting Notes: Malty, Bitter, Roasty, Nutty

Heart & Soul 4.4 Vocation Brewery

Created to have all the hoppy goodness of an IPA, but brewed to a sessionable strength. Its intense fruit-salad character comes from generous additions of US West Coast hops.

Tasting Notes: A full bodied and fruity beer, with notes of passion fruit, grapefruit, gooseberry, pineapple & mango

Tiger Rut 4.0 Millstone Brewery

A very pale and hoppy ale. Brewed using only the Chinook hop, mellow bitters make way for a distinctive citrus aroma.

Tasting Notes: Hoppy, citrus

White Rat 4.0 Ossett Brewery

Hoppy Pale Ale

Tasting Notes: This very pale, hoppy ale is made from low colour malt. A combination of Cascade, Columbus & Amarillo hops produce an intensely aromatic and resinous finish.
